On Wed, Aug 29, 2018 at 06:09:53PM +0000, Gunnlaugur Thor Briem wrote:
> Hi,
>
> I'm trying to upgrade an old PG 9.4 cluster to PG 10, and it's failing on
> creating an index that uses the unaccent(text) function.
>
> That function is part of the unaccent extension, which is installed in the old
> DB cluster. I expect pg_upgrade to create that extension as part of the
> upgrade. It does create other extensions that are installed in the old DB
> cluster. I don't get why this one isn't included.
This is caused by security changes made in PG 10.3 and other minor
releases. Please see this thread for an outline of the issue:
https://www.postgresql.org/message-id/flat/152106914669.1223.5104148605998271987%40wrigleys.postgresql.org
I think you have to change your index function to specify the schema
name before the unacces function call, e.g.
SELECT lower(public.unaccent(btrim(regexp_replace(
